Judith K. Tarman, 78 of Hatboro, PA passed away on January 15, 2020. She was the beloved wife of John (Jack) Tarman Jr with whom she shared 59 years of marriage. She was born on November 1, 1941 in Abington, PA and was the daughter of the late Howard and Marie Kirk.
After graduating from Abington High School, Judy worked at Sun-Oil Company in Philadelphia Pa. Judy then married Jack who was her high school sweetheart. Judy was a very dedicated Wife, Mother, grand mother and great grandmother. Family was everything to her and she took every opportunity to spend time with them. Judy enjoyed her family vacations to the Jersey shore in Wildwood and Cape May as well as trips to the Zoo with her grandchildren. When her children were in school Judy was an active member of the various parent organizations. She dedicated many hours to the Upper Moreland Music Patrons and attended virtually every performance throughout all four of her children's and granddaughter's marching band careers. Judy seldom missed any of her children's or grandchildren's sporting events, school events, or church events. For many years Judy was involved with the ladies auxiliary of the Willow Grove Volunteer Fire company and made several life long friendships that endured well beyond their involvement in the organization. Judy was an active member of Jenkintown United Methodist Church before transferring to Lehman United Methodist where she made yet more life long and cherished friendships. Judy is remembered by her family and friends as a very kind and giving person who always had a smile on her face and a warm greeting for everyone she met. Judy will be greatly missed.
